Is umbrella a short or long U?

The short “u” sound says “uh,” as in “umbrella” and “bug.” The long “u” sound, on the other hand, is a little less common. It’s heard in words like “huge.” When teaching phonics, start with the short vowel sounds first. They are more common and are less confusing to kids.

Which is correct an umbrella or a umbrella?

The first sound that is pronounced is a vowel, so “an” is used. “Umbrella” begins with a vowel sound, but the adjective “blue” appears between “umbrella” and the indefinite article, and “blue” begins with a consonant sound. For that reason, “a” is used.

Do we use an umbrella?

It is designed to protect a person against rain or sunlight. The term umbrella is traditionally used when protecting oneself from rain, with parasol used when protecting oneself from sunlight, though the terms continue to be used interchangeably.

What are examples of long and short vowels?

The short vowels can represented by a curved symbol above the vowel: ă, ĕ, ĭ, ŏ, ŭ. The long vowels can be represented by a horizontal line above the vowel: ā, ē, ī, ō, ū. Here are some examples of short vowel words: at, egg, it, ox, up. Here are some examples of long vowel words: ate, each, ice, oak, use.

What are short vowel sounds?

The term short vowel is used to refer to the sounds that most often correspond to the letters ‘a,’ ‘e,’ ‘i,’ ‘o,’ and ‘u’ when the vowel occurs individually between consonants (Consonant-Vowel-Consonant, or CVC pattern).
